What you need to know about the Milwaukee Bucks
This season, Milwaukee is averaging 113.1 points per game (18th-ranked in NBA) and ceding 111.5 points per contest (sixth-ranked). The Bucks put up 117.8 points per game at home, compared to 108.3 points per game when playing on the road, a difference of 9.5 points per contest. The Bucks have seen an uptick in scoring recently, racking up 115.2 points per game in their last 10 contests, 2.1 points more than the 113.1 they’ve scored this year.
Milwaukee is top-five this year in three-point shooting, ranking fifth-best in the league with 14.2 treys per game. Meanwhile, it ranks 15th with a 35.9% shooting percentage from downtown. Of the shots taken by the Bucks in 2022-23, 55.9% of them have been two-pointers (65.5% of the team’s made baskets) and 44.1% have been threes (34.5%).

What you need to know about the Indiana Pacers
In 2022-23, Indiana is 12th in the NBA offensively (115.1 points scored per game) and 24th defensively (116.8 points allowed). The Pacers are scoring more points at home (117.8 per game) than on the road (112.4). Over their past 10 games, the Pacers are posting 113.1 points per contest, compared to their season average of 115.1.
Indiana makes 13.9 3-pointers per game and shoots 36.2% from beyond the arc, ranking sixth and 13th, respectively, in the NBA. The Pacers attempt 42.8% percent of their shots from behind the 3-point line, and 57.2% percent from inside it. In terms of makes, 34% of the Pacers’ baskets are 3-pointers, and 66% are 2-pointers.
